The final amount for your new floors depends on a few specific things. First, it comes down to the material you choose, whether that is hardwood, luxury vinyl, or carpet. The size of the area being covered and how much prep work the subfloor needs will also play a role. If your rooms have complex layouts or lots of corners, that often adds labor time. This service covers the professional placement of engineered or solid wood planks throughout your home. You need this when you are replacing worn-out surfaces or finishing a new construction project. The process involves prepping your subfloor, moisture testing, and precise board alignment for a seamless look. It is the best choice if you want to increase your home’s value and improve indoor air quality. We focus on proper expansion gaps to ensure your floor stays flat and beautiful for many years.

The 1-3 rule for flooring involves leaving an expansion gap of roughly 1/3 inch around the room's perimeter. This is crucial for solid and engineered wood to accommodate natural expansion and contraction due to humidity changes, a key factor in Murfreesboro's climate. Proper installation ensures your floors stay beautiful.
Vinyl plank flooring is a strong contender for its exceptional water resistance, ideal for kitchens and dining areas in Murfreesboro homes. Laminate is often more budget-friendly and provides a realistic wood appearance. The specialists can help you decide which best suits your lifestyle and home.
